Corn yield response to increasing nitrogen (N) rate follows the Law of Diminishing Returns – as higher and higher increments of N are applied, the increase in grain yield becomes smaller and smaller (Figure 1). Eventually, maximum yield occurs and applying more N does not increase yield any further.
